Prime Minister Concerns Over $2,100-$2,900/m² Apartment Prices, Vietnam Young Entrepreneurs Association Pledges 10,000 Social Housing Units Next Year

The Vietnam Young Entrepreneurs Association has announced that its members will promptly register to submit a report to the Prime Minister regarding the implementation of social housing initiatives.

On November 27th, the 8th National Congress of the Vietnam Young Entrepreneurs Association for the 2025-2030 term was held.

In his keynote address, the Prime Minister acknowledged the contributions of the business community, particularly young entrepreneurs, who have made significant strides, built brands that resonate regionally and globally, and elevated the nation’s standing.

Under the motto “Proactive State – Pioneering Businesses – Public-Private Partnership,” the Prime Minister urged the Vietnam Young Entrepreneurs Association and its members to elevate their mindset, think boldly, act ambitiously, value knowledge, and make decisive moves to seize opportunities.

The Prime Minister called on young entrepreneurs to lead in: fostering a generation of entrepreneurs with ideals and social responsibility; promoting startups, innovation, green transformation, and transparent governance; strengthening linkages and cooperation to form value chains and innovation hubs; and actively contributing to policy-making, partnering with the government, and meeting public expectations.

Beyond charitable activities like supporting flood and drought victims or eliminating makeshift housing, the Prime Minister emphasized the need for businesses to pioneer affordable housing development, enabling citizens, especially young people, to settle and thrive.

The Prime Minister also urged real estate companies and businesses new to this sector to embrace social responsibility, boldly invest in affordable housing, while the government continues to refine supportive policies and mechanisms.

“With apartment prices at 50-70 million VND per square meter, how can young people afford to buy without family, community, or societal support? Simplified policies and land-use fee exemptions are already in place. I urge the Association to launch programs, rally entrepreneurs to step up, and ensure actions follow words,” the Prime Minister stated.

The Prime Minister directed ministries, agencies, and localities to create a conducive environment for businesses through streamlined policies, synchronized infrastructure, and efficient governance. He also called for transparent procedures, reduced costs for citizens and businesses, and continued institutional reforms to drive development.

Responding to the Prime Minister’s remarks on affordable housing amid rising property prices, Mr. Dang Hong Anh announced: “After urgent discussions with the Association’s Central Standing Committee, we commit to starting construction on at least 10,000 affordable housing units in 2026. Members will register and report progress to the Prime Minister.”

In his presentation at the congress, Mr. Nguyen Van Khoa, CEO of FPT, noted that while the private sector contributes 42% of GDP, employs 75% of the workforce, and generates 55% of total income, it still lacks the competitiveness to directly challenge global conglomerates.

He highlighted the immense pressure on young entrepreneurs to invest heavily in technology, research, and innovation. To break through, he proposed three strategies: developing human resources; advancing science, technology, data, and new energy sources; and innovating business models while building interconnected ecosystems to share value.
